BattlEye only needs to be active during online play sessions, such as when playing GTA Online. Depending on your platform (Rockstar Games Launcher, Epic, Steam), you can change the setting or launch option to disable BattlEye for Story Mode.
https://support.rockstargames.com/articles/33490543992467/Grand-Theft-Auto-Online-BattlEye-FAQ
on Steam you add -nobattleye to the Launch Options, right-click on Grand Theft Auto V in your library- select Properties - General
I'd go to the location it lists -
c / windows / system32 / and RENAME D3DCompiler_43.dl to -old. Then go to -
steam / steamapps / common / steamworks shared / _commonredist / directx / Jun2010
And rightclick dxsetup, run as admin - and install reinstall directx9.
You could also go grab an updated version from M$ or something.
Either of thse -should- clean install/reinstall this file for you
Restart pc after for good measure.
Battleye really shouldn't be choking on that file if it is a default/legit/valid, etc file.

FAQ
When launching the game I get an “Update failed …” error.
In order for BE to operate properly, it needs to be able to download updates prior to launching the game. If this fails for you please make sure that your system and network has unrestricted internet access. Furthermore, if you are using a firewall or similar security software, please ensure that the BE Launcher executable (often named “[Game name]_BE.exe”) is allowed to access the internet without restrictions. You may want to add the BE Launcher executable to the software’s exception list as well.
